LAPLACE

The LAPLACE was born on the 1st of January 2007 resulting from the merger of three mixed-research units (CPAT, LGET, LEEI) and a welcome team (LE), the LAPLACE is the most important research concentration in France for electrical power and plasmas. In 2009 the LAME electronics laboratory has joined the Laplace. The research group “Lumière & Matière”, represented by a task force of 20 researchers and PhD students, has continuing interest in lighting systems since 1970.

In this project LAPLACE is involved in photometric characterisation of LED products in order to support SMEs in SSL for evaluating the quality and providing advice to lighting designers who are looking for innovative energy saving solutions.
